Search
Close this search box.
Search
Close this search box.
Search
Close this search box.

New Mediterranean restaurant celebrates grand opening in St. Pete Beach

New Mediterranean restaurant celebrates grand opening in St. Pete Beach

Bartenders behind a bar
Photo courtesy Taverna On The Bay

Opa! A new restaurant is now open in a prime location in St. Pete Beach, replacing a recently shuttered favorite. Taverna On The Bay celebrates its grand opening today at 5501 Gulf Boulevard, occupying the building most recently home to Caddy’s St. Pete Beach.

The new beach restaurant showcases an excellent selection of Mediterranean eats, promising “A taste you’ll never forget OPAAA!” Taverna On The Bay is in the same complex as the Beach Zone store and Sunshine City Comedy Club, located across Gulf Boulevard from Tradewinds Islands Resorts.

ADVERTISEMENT

Food at Taverna On The Bay
Food at Taverna On The Bay
Photos courtesy Taverna On The Bay

After announcing the upcoming opening earlier this summer, diners were left in a bit of suspense as to what exactly to expect. Now, we’ve gotten a look at the menu, and it appears Taverna On The Bay was worth the wait.

The menu features a wide selection of Greek-inspired specialty seafood dishes, grilled steaks and chops, pasta plates, and a deep selection of chicken and veal entrees. And don’t skip dessert, with options such as Galaktoboureko and Palacinke, as well as cheesecake and creme brûlée.

Highlights from the entree list include garlic parmesan flounder, Greek-seasoned baby lamb chops, seafood pescatore, Greek stuffed chicken, and veal marsala. The bar also features a full cocktail menu along with beer and wine.

ADVERTISEMENT

The restaurant is open daily from 11 am – 10 pm. Follow Taverna On The Bay on Facebook for more updates.

What to read next: 

ADVERTISEMENT

Subscribe Now

Don’t miss out on All Things Good in the Burg 👉
👇 GET UPDATES 👇

Stay connected to All Things Good in the Burg by subscribing today.